Please don't send people to SAIO when they are in production.
The appropriate guide is the former "multinode" guide. It appears
to be folded into OpenStack Installation here:
 https://docs.openstack.org/swift/wallaby/install/storage-install.html
Also, the source is readable in RST files:
 https://opendev.org/openstack/swift/src/branch/master/doc/source/install
